#465875 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#465875 is composed of 27.5% red, 34.5%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.2% cyan, 24.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 217 degrees, a saturation of 25.1% and a lightness of 36.7%. #465875 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cb0ea with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#465875 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#465875 has RGB values of R:70, G:88,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 4610165.
